#b692b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b692b4 is composed of 71.4% red, 57.3%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.8% magenta, 1.1%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 303.3 degrees, a saturation of 19.8% and a lightness of 64.3%. #b692b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6d2569.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#b692b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b692b4 has RGB values of R:182, G:146,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.01,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11965108.
